如何远程连接MySQL和GaussDB数据库?

MySQL远程连接数据库的两种方法及GaussDB远程连接配置方法如下:,,1. 使用命令行工具(如mysql、mysqldump等)通过TCP/IP协议连接到远程数据库服务器。,2. 使用图形界面工具(如phpMyAdmin、MySQL Workbench等)连接到远程数据库服务器。,,GaussDB远程连接配置方法如下:,,1. 在GaussDB服务器上安装并配置好MySQL服务。,2. 在客户端计算机上安装MySQL客户端工具,如mysql、mysqldump等。,3. 修改GaussDB服务器上的MySQL配置文件(my.cnf或my.ini),允许远程连接。将bindaddress设置为0.0.0.0,表示允许任何IP地址连接。,4. 重启GaussDB服务器上的MySQL服务以使配置生效。,5. 在客户端计算机上使用MySQL客户端工具连接到GaussDB服务器,指定服务器IP地址、端口号、用户名和密码。

MySQL远程连接数据库的两种方法如下:

如何远程连接MySQL和GaussDB数据库?

方法一:改表法

1、登录本地MySQL:在本地计算机上打开命令提示符或终端,输入以下命令以登录到MySQL服务器(假设用户名为root,密码为your_password):

   mysql u root p

2、选择MySQL数据库:登录后,选择MySQL数据库,输入以下命令:

   use mysql;

3、修改用户表:将“user”表中的“host”字段由“localhost”改为“%”,以允许任何主机进行连接,修改root用户的host字段,输入以下命令:

   update user set host = '%' where user = 'root';

4、查询修改结果:输入以下命令以确认修改是否成功:

   select host, user from user;

5、刷新权限:输入以下命令以使更改生效:

如何远程连接MySQL和GaussDB数据库?

   flush privileges;

方法二:授权法

1、登录本地MySQL:与改表法的第一步相同,登录到MySQL服务器。

2、创建新用户并授权:为新用户分配权限,创建一个新用户myuser,并允许其从任何主机连接到MySQL服务器,使用以下命令:

   CREATE USER 'myuser'@'%' IDENTIFIED BY 'mypassword';
   GRANT ALL PRIVILEGES ON *.* TO 'myuser'@'%' WITH GRANT OPTION;

3、刷新权限:同样,输入以下命令以使更改生效:

   FLUSH PRIVILEGES;

GaussDB远程连接配置方法

对于GaussDB(华为云数据库),远程连接的配置方法略有不同,以下是一般步骤:

如何远程连接MySQL和GaussDB数据库?

1、登录GaussDB控制台:访问华为云官网,登录您的华为云账号,进入“GaussDB”控制台。

2、获取连接信息:在GaussDB控制台中,找到您需要连接的数据库实例,记录下其连接地址、端口号、用户名和密码。

3、配置安全组规则:确保数据库实例的安全组规则允许外部设备访问,如果不清楚如何配置,可以联系华为云客服寻求帮助。

4、使用客户端工具连接:使用支持GaussDB的客户端工具(如pgAdmin、DBeaver等)连接到数据库,在连接设置中,输入第2步中获取的连接信息。

步骤仅为一般指导,具体操作可能因GaussDB的版本和配置而有所不同,建议参考GaussDB的官方文档或联系华为云客服获取更详细的指导。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1233102.html

(0)
未希的头像未希新媒体运营
上一篇 2024-10-22 23:15
下一篇 2024-10-22 23:25

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免费注册
电话联系

400-880-8834

产品咨询
产品咨询
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入